Individuals who handle products exposed to a hazardous substance can avoid injury if they

 

are informed of, and understand, the hazard. If the product being returned was exposed to a

 

hazardous substance as defined by OSHA, a copy of the required Material Safety Data

 

Sheet (MSDS) for each hazardous substance identified must be included with the returned

 

goods.
